艾滋病诊疗指南(2011版)中华医学会感染病学分会艾滋病学组
目前,艾滋病不仅已成为严重威胁我国人民健康的公共卫生问题,且已影响到经济发展和社会稳定。

根据卫生部指示,中华医学会感染病学分会艾滋病学组牵头于2005年制订了我国《艾滋病诊疗指南》第一版(下简称指南)。

本版在2005年指南的基础上参照国内外最新研究成果和临床实践修订而成。

本指南将根据最新的临床医学证据进行定期的修改和更新。
